Yeah OK | |
Type: | studio |
Artist: | Not Squares |
Cover: | Yeah OK album.jpg |
Released: | December 6, 2010 |
Yeah OK is an album by Not Squares. The album was released on December 6, 2010, by the Richter Collective in the UK and Ireland and by Teto Records in Japan.